Description

The Cargill Agricultural Supply Chain (CASC) connects producers and users of grains and oilseeds around the globe through sourcing, storing, trading, processing and distributing grains and oilseeds, as well as offering a range of financial, risk management and customized farmer services. Working at Cargill is an opportunity to thrive  a place to develop your career to the fullest while engaging in meaningful work that makes a positive impact around the globe! #sksupportsukraine

Principal Accountabilities:

Perform the daily operations of the facility safely, efficiently and profitably.
Provide excellent customer service and engaging with team members
Maintain a safe and clean work environment
Other duties as assigned under the direction of the Retail Manager and Plant Manger

Required Qualifications:    

Must be legally entitled to work for Cargill in Canada
Must be 18 years or older
Ability to perform physical job duties which may include bending, lifting up to 50 lbs, kneeling, climbing, crawling, and twisting safely, with or without a reasonable accommodation.
Ability to understand and communicate in English (verbal/written)
Basic use of a computer
Ability to work in varied indoor and outdoor conditions which may include heat, cold, dust, loud noise, etc., with the use of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)
Ability to work in elevated areas (4 feet and above)
Possess a valid Canadian Class 5 drivers license and be able to safely operate a 5 ton delivery van
